Watering Japanese Lily and Ayers Pear

Water is the most essential need of any plant. Watering requirements differ for every plant. Knowing the amount of water required is the most important part of Japanese Lily and Ayers Pear Facts. One needs to adequately water the plants keeping in mind that plants need season wise variations in water levels. While taking Japanese Lily and Ayers Pear care, it is important to know that too much water is more dangerous than not enough watering. Here we provide you with the exact watering required for your garden plant. Watering Japanese Lily and Ayers Pear is as follows:

  • Watering Japanese Lily in Summer: Lots of watering

  • Watering Japanese Lily in Winter: Average Water

  • Watering Ayers Pear in Summer: Lots of watering

  • Watering Ayers Pear in Winter: Average Water

Japanese Lily and Ayers Pear Pruning

Pruning is an important part of Japanese Lily and Ayers Pear care. Pruning helps to grow the plant with a faster rate. Japanese Lily and Ayers Pear pruning is done as follows:

  • Japanese Lily pruning: Prune in early spring, Prune in fall and Remove dead or diseased plant parts

  • Ayers Pear pruning: Remove damaged leaves, Remove dead branches and Remove dead leaves

Plants need fertilizers for its growth and increasing the life. Japanese Lily and Ayers Pear fertilizers are as follows:

  • Japanese Lily fertilizers: All-Purpose Liquid Fertilizer, Compost, Fertilize only when soil is poor and slow-release fertilizers
  • Ayers Pear fertilizers: All-Purpose Liquid Fertilizer
